Rot rep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the integrity of residential and commercial rot-prone wood structures. This service covers a variety of projects, including replacing decayed porch posts, repairing damaged fascia boards, and restoring window frames affected by moisture or insect damage. Property owners typically want to understand the extent of wood deterioration, the types of repair or replacement options available, and how to prevent future rot issues to protect the longevity of their structures.
Before requesting rot repair services, homeowners should assess the visible signs of wood decay such as soft spots, discoloration, or sagging surfaces. It’s important to identify the areas affected and determine whether the damage is localized or widespread. Understanding the scope of the project helps in planning appropriate repairs and ensures that the necessary materials and techniques are used to effectively address the rot and reinforce the affected structures.

Rot Repair Service Questions
What causes rot in wooden structures? Rot is typically caused by prolonged exposure to moisture, which promotes fungal growth and wood decay.
How can I tell if my wood has rot? Signs include soft, spongy areas, discoloration, and visible mold or fungi on the surface.
What types of projects require rot repair? Common projects include deck repairs, porch columns, window frames, and fencing that show signs of deterioration.
Why is timely rot repair important? Addressing rot early helps prevent further structural damage and maintains the safety of the property.
